Yerger Middle School welcomes a new program to the 7th and 8th curriculum. This new program is called Project Lead the Way (PLTW). PLTW offers engaging subjects to challenge the students to advance to new heights. These offering include Flight and Space, Automation and Robotics, Medical Detective, and Design and Modeling.

Corporal Justin Dean, school resource officer for Hope Public Schools, made a surprise appearance in the Yerger Middle School Robotics class. Corp. Dean participated in the class discussion by providing information about robots and technology that can be found in police departments to aid with the day to day operations. He also provided great commentary regarding technology advancements in the home.
